> > Currently, Kylin will load the hive configuration from the
> HIVE_DEPENDENCY
> > classpath. That means Kylin supports only one hive source. KYLIN-1826
> aims
> > to support multiple hive data sources, but the design is a little
> > complicated by introducing the EXTERNAL HIVE concepts.
> >
> > The data source management becomes more tricky when multiple hive
> clusters
> > and multiple kafka clusters are needed. I just rise the question today
> > without specific solution yet, all suggestions are welcomed. I think it
> > could be very useful if Kylin could support data source management.
> >
> > It should have the following features:
> > 1. Defines Hive Cluster/Kafka Cluster as the data source factory under
> > Project.
> > 2. One Project could have more than one Hive/Kafka/SparkSQL Cluster
> > definitions.
> > 3. When "Load Table/Streaming", Kylin could load the TABLE(Hive) and
> > Topic(Kafka) definition from Hive/Kafka directly.
> > 4. The following model design and cube build are the same as before
> still.
> >
